What are Cookies?

A Сookie is a small piece of information that is downloaded to your computer or mobile device, enabling certain functions. Cookies make it easier and more convenient to use websites and applications and provide a more personalized user experience.

3.Personal Data we don’t collect

TalentPay does not intentionally collect any sensitive Personal Data, such as data revealing your racial or ethnic origin, political opinions, religious or philosophical beliefs, trade union membership, genetic or biometric data for the purpose of uniquely identifying a natural person, or data concerning your health or sex life or sexual orientation, as defined under Article 9 of the GDPR and other applicable laws.

You are strongly advised not to submit any such information when using our Services, unless explicitly requested by TalentPay and required for a lawful purpose.

If, in exceptional cases, TalentPay reasonably needs to collect and process such sensitive Personal Data, we will provide you with a clear explanation of the purpose and lawful basis for such processing, and will request your explicit consent, where required by applicable data protection law.

TalentPay also implements reasonable measures to detect and delete any inadvertently collected sensitive Personal Data that is not required for the performance of the Services.
